1

閉じられていないタグを提供する正規表現が必要です。それらを見つけて、プログラムで閉じることができます。

のように、私はテキストの下にあります

<tag>
<p> hello world <p> this is <p>test.</p> this is test. <p> end it 
</tag>

これから閉じられていないタグを見つけて、正規表現を使用して閉じたいと思います。

何か案が??ありがとうメガナ

4

1 に答える 1

6

正規表現は、このタスクに適したツールではありません。その理由の説得力のあるデモンストレーションについては、こちらを参照してください。

HTML Agility Packを使用して HTML を解析し、書き換えることをお勧めします。

于 2012-04-23T12:22:49.903 に答える